State Supt. Walters releases patriotic displays guidelines | News [Video]

OKLAHOMA — Oklahoma State Supt. Ryan Walters released guidelines on patriotic displays in school districts on Thursday after Edmond Public Schools prohibited students from displaying the American Flag.

“No school in Oklahoma should tell students they can’t wave an American flag,” said Walters in a press release. “Americans have fought and died for the right to carry our flag, and no student should ever be targeted for exercising that right. Our young people should never have to fear displaying their patriotism and I will fight every day so that when our students want to express their love for America, they can do so boldly and proudly.”

Walters’ Office said the American flag represents values the nation was built upon and the Pledge of Allegiance serves as a reminder of our commitment to those principles. Incorporating these symbols into schools instills patriotism and civic duty in students, Walters’ Office said.
